Hyderabad Customs deposits Rs3.9m into exchequer during June

byAslam Anjum Qureshi
01/07/2017
in Latest News, National
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

HYDERABAD: The Model Customs Collectorate Hyderabad State Warehouse deposited Rs3.9million into the national exchequer. The amount was collected through auction and duty/taxes during the month of June 2017. These goods were seized by the Anti-Smuggling Organization (ASO) on the instructions of Hyderabad Collector Akhlaq Ahmad Khattaq under the supervision of Additional Collector Rehmatulah Vistro.

The collectorate has released the seized consignments of foreign origin two Toyota surf modelled 1996, Suzuki Jimny 1994 and non-duty-paid black pepper after receiving the taxable duty and taxes of abovementioned amount during the month of June 2017. Through auction and following all duty and taxes including customs duty, import duty, sale proceed and fine and penalties, Motamar alam-E-Islami (MI) deposited Rs2.9million sale taxes, Rs555536 federal excise duty, duty on import goods, FED and advance income tax and duty of Rs432112 earned from smuggled items including cigarettes and non-duty-paid vehicles during June 2017.
